INTERNAL MEMO — Branch Managers. The pilot with Dunmore Retail Group starts in six stores next month. Our Cartwheel checkout units ship week one; training is week two. Keep staffing flat. Report footfall and uptime daily to regional ops. Do not discuss the pilot with suppliers or press. Success criteria: 95% uptime, under two-minute queue times. A full rollout decision follows the eight-week review. The underlying plan is summarized in the note below.

internal memo for tajof-kaduf: Only 65 of the 511 pilot accounts renewed Lamdor, so a churn review is set for January 26. Aldmirek Works is in early talks to buy Alddorox Works for about $490.9 million.

**Ticket: Snapshot bundle failing signature check in CI**

Hey — welcome aboard! First task: the Lumenkit UI snapshot suite is failing in CI, but not because the snapshots drifted. The snapshot baseline bundle itself is failing signature verification, so the runner refuses to load it and every component test errors out. We think the baseline was re-uploaded without being re-signed after last week's refactor. Please regenerate the bundle, sign it, and push it back to the artifact store. The signing key you'll need is below.

deploy key for kaduf-bagep: bky6_NNeq4d

**Mgmt Meeting Minutes — Retiring the Brightline Range**

Quick recap for sales leads at Fenholt Supplies: we agreed to retire the Brightline fixture range by year-end. Remaining stock moves to clearance pricing next month, and accounts on standing orders get migrated to the Lumetta range. Trade-in incentives were approved in principle. The confidential note on next steps sits just below.

board note of bajof-bajeg: The pricing group signed off on a budget of $13.4 million for Project Sildor. The renewal with Lamixek Holdings closes at $48.9 million a year, 49 percent above the last contract.

Runbook: Retrying Failed Exports — Quillgate

If a Quillgate export batch fails, do not re-run the whole window. Identify the failed batch IDs from the job log, then trigger a targeted retry. Retries are idempotent; duplicates are deduplicated downstream. A release should not proceed while retries are pending. Confirm the retry worker is reading the settings shown below.

settings of yageg-yahap:
[gorael]
team = olieth
access_code = ac_941d74
owner = brieth.aldiel
host = gorael.tolvaqio.internal
port = 6379
peer = briwyn.urlaqtech.internal
salt = 116e6622
pin = 1957